Attention: All parts were designed to be snapped together without the need for glue. Please print everything with a 0.16mm layer height and 0.4mm extrusion width, in a printer with a well-tuned extruder (Check [this page] https://teachingtechyt.github.io/calibration.html#esteps "Teaching Tech") to learn how to do it.
Bill of Materials
- 1x Wemos D1 mini;
- WS2812b led strip, make sure you choose IP30 any other IP rating wouldn't make any sense and might not even fit. I would recommend buying a strip with 60 leds/m or more.
*1 x 22 AWG 3 pin RGB cable
- USB 2.0 A-Male to Micro B Charger Cable
- USB Power Adaptor
White filament for the bellWhatever color filament for everything else.

Step 3, Assemble the Base with the Wemos D1
Solder the wires in the Wemos D1 following the diagram below:
Insert the Wemos D1 mini in the Base 2 printed part, passing the 3 wires through the wire hole.
Step 4, Assemble the LEDs
Cut 4 LED's, and cut the out contacts to make more room. Attention: Double-check which side you are cutting the contacts on as the LED strip had an in and out connections. My LED strip had a small triangle indicating the in side.
Solder the cables to the LED strip minding its current orientation to avoid having to twist the cables later.
Please don't judge my soldering skills....lol
Step 5, LEDs placement and finishing assembling the base
After soldering everything and making sure the LED strip is soldered in the right orientation, stick the LED's in place inside the Base 1 printed part.
More picture detailing how the LED's should be installed inside the Base 1.Don't stick them before soldering!
Connect both parts of the Base using a piece of 1.75mm filament as the connecting pin in both ends of the Base
Cut the excess filament on both ends.
Last, snap in place the Base Cover, closing the Wemos D1 mini compartment.
Step 6, Assemble the notification bell LED cover
Snap in place the Bell printed parts.
Finish assembling by snapping in place the assembled LED cover to the Base
Software
I use the notification bell in conjunction with Home Assistant.
In order to make it work installed ESPHome in the Wemos D1 mini.
